How they compare
Ethiopia currently reports 1,548 kg per hectare against 1,253 kg per hectare in Libya, a difference of 295 kg per hectare.
That makes Ethiopia's figure about 1.2 times Libya's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 19 shared years of data; in 1993 it was Libya ahead.
Ethiopia ranks 3rd and Libya ranks 6th of 37 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Ethiopia averaged higher in 1 and Libya in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Ethiopia | Libya |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 827.89 kg per hectare | 1,146 kg per hectare | 317.83 kg per hectare | Libya |
| 2000s | 1,106 kg per hectare | 1,163 kg per hectare | 56.73 kg per hectare | Libya |
| 2010s | 1,484 kg per hectare | 1,210 kg per hectare | 274.45 kg per hectare | Ethiopia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Rice yield, measured as kilograms per hectare of harvested land. Production data on relate to crops harvested for dry grain only. Crop harvested for hay or harvested green for food, feed, or silage and those used for grazing are excluded.
